
with regards to the Answer Man in The Pumper-My forty plus years of experience indicates that the older septic systems using crushed stone for the drainage medium work better and longer than the new systems approved in many states being used under the same conditions with similiar usage and soil conditions. The systems are also less prone to be damaged when covering.
